Output 15d62bf34eb19687bb260a1b3483a0c3e1f837fe14ee7878b5afde00be5de7fb:4

value
31385957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f90f3763ab9991868eaf3f82a3d4bcbebc0cb8 OP_EQUAL
address
MEv9wxn5WPU15kTPPj61JALjKNCm5363Wm
transaction
15d62bf34eb19687bb260a1b3483a0c3e1f837fe14ee7878b5afde00be5de7fb
spent
true